Common Ro System Replacement Jobs
RO System Replacement - Upgrading an aging or malfunctioning reverse osmosis system to ensure clean, fresh drinking water.
Filter Cartridge Replacement - Swapping out worn or clogged filters to maintain optimal water quality.
Complete System Replacement - Installing a new RO unit when the existing system is beyond repair or outdated.
Pre-Filter and Post-Filter Replacement - Refreshing filters to improve system performance and extend its lifespan.
Membrane Replacement - Replacing the RO membrane to restore effective filtration and water flow.
System Upgrade Services - Upgrading to newer, more efficient RO systems for better water quality and performance.
Ro System Replacement Questions
When should an RO system be replaced? The system should be replaced when it shows signs of reduced water quality, frequent repairs, or after the recommended service interval specified by the manufacturer.
What are signs that an RO system needs replacement? Common signs include decreased water flow, bad taste or odor, and increased filter maintenance frequency.
Can I replace the RO system myself? Replacing an RO system involves handling plumbing and filters, so it is recommended to have a professional perform the replacement for proper installation and performance.
What types of RO systems are available for replacement? There are various models designed for different household needs, including under-sink units, countertop systems, and whole-house setups.
